ISPMT
Aplica-se a:Coluna calculadaTabela calculadaMeasureCálculo visual
Calcula os juros pagos (orreceived) para o período especificado de um empréstimo (or investimento) com even pagamentos de capital.
Sintaxe
ISPMT(<rate>, <per>, <nper>, <pv>)
Parâmetros
Vigência | Definição |
---|---|
rate |
Os juros rate para o investimento. |
per |
O período para o qual pretende find os juros. Deve estar entre 0 andnper-1 (inclusive). |
nper |
O número total de prazos de pagamento para o investimento. |
pv |
O presente value do investimento. Para um empréstimo, pv é o valor do empréstimo. |
Regresso Value
Os juros pagos (orreceived) para o período especificado.
Comentários
Certifique-se de que você é consistente sobre as unidades que você usa para especificar rateandnper. If você fizer pagamentos mensais em um empréstimo de quatroyear a um rate de juros anual de 12%, use 0,12/12 para rateand 4 * 12 para nper. If você fizer pagamentos anuais sobre o mesmo empréstimo, use 0,12 para rateand 4 para nper.
Para all argumentos, o dinheiro que você paga, como depósitos na poupança or outros saques, é representado por números negativos; O dinheiro que você recebe, como cheques de dividendos and outros depósitos, é representado por números positivos.
ISPMT conta cada período que começa com zero not um.
A maioria dos empréstimos usa um cronograma de reembolso com even pagamentos periódicos. A função IPMT devolve o pagamento de juros de um determinado período para este tipo de empréstimo.
Alguns empréstimos utilizam um calendário de reembolso com even pagamentos de capital. A função ISPMT devolve o pagamento de juros de um determinado período para este tipo de empréstimo.
Uma error é devolvida if:
- nper = 0.
Esta função not é suportada para uso no modo DirectQuery quando usada em colunas calculadas or regras de segurança em nível de linha (RLS).
Exemplo
de dados | Descrição |
---|---|
\$4.000 | O momento value |
4 | Número de períodos |
10% | Rate |
Para ilustrar quando usar ISPMT, a tabela de amortização abaixo usa um cronograma de reembolso de capital evencom os termos especificados acima. A cobrança de juros em cada período é igual ao rate vezes o saldo não pago do período previous. And o pagamento, cada período é igual ao even capital acrescido dos juros do período.
Ponto final | Pagamento Principal | Pagamento de Juros | Pagamento Total | Equilíbrio |
---|---|---|---|---|
4,000.00 | ||||
1 | 1,000.00 | 400.00 | 1,400.00 | 3,000.00 |
2 | 1,000.00 | 300.00 | 1,300.00 | 2,000.00 |
3 | 1,000.00 | 200.00 | 1,200.00 | 1,000.00 |
4 | 1,000.00 | 100.00 | 1,100.00 | 0.00 |
O seguinte DAX consulta:
DEFINE
VAR NumPaymentPeriods = 4
VAR PaymentPeriods = GENERATESERIES(0, NumPaymentPeriods-1)
EVALUATE
ADDCOLUMNS (
PaymentPeriods,
"Interest Payment",
ISPMT(0.1, [Value], NumPaymentPeriods, 4000)
)
Devolve os juros pagos durante cada período, utilizando o calendário de reembolso do capital evenand termos especificados acima. Os values são negativos para indicar que são juros pagos, notreceived.
[Value] | [Pagamento de Juros] |
---|---|
0 | -400 |
1 | -300 |
2 | -200 |
3 | -100 |